What You’ll Need

Gather these simple ingredients to make your Caramel Apple Cheesecake Bars:

  • 1 cup shortbread cookies, crushed
  • 1/4 cup unsalted butter, melted
  • 2 (8-ounce) packages cream cheese, softened
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 2 large eggs
  • 2 cups apples, peeled and diced
  • 1 teaspoon cinnamon
  • 1 cup rolled oats
  • 1/2 cup brown sugar
  • 1/4 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/4 cup unsalted butter, melted (for topping)
  • Caramel sauce for drizzling

Let’s Make It Together

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ease a 9×9 inch baking pan.
  2. In a mixing bowl, combine the crushed shortbread cookies and melted butter. Press the mixture into the bottom of the prepared baking pan to form a crust.
  3. In another bowl, beat the cream cheese, granulated sugar, and vanilla until smooth. Add e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ition. Pour the cheesecake mixture over the crust.
  4. In a separate bowl, toss the diced apples with cinnamon and spread them over the cheesecake layer.
  5. For the crumble topping, combine rolled oats, brown sugar, flour, and melted butter in a bowl. Sprinkle the mixture over the apples.
  6. Bake for 40-45 minutes, or until set and lightly golden.
  7. Allow to cool, then drizzle with caramel sauce before serving.

Fun Ways to Customize It

  • Nutty Addition: Stir in some chopped pecans or walnuts into the crumble topping for that extra crunch and nutty flavor.
  • Spiced Up Apples: Add a splash of nutmeg or ginger to the diced apples to give them a warming, zesty kick.
  • Chocolate Drizzle: For a rich twist, drizzle some melted chocolate over the caramel for those chocoholics in your life.
  • Different Fruits: Instead of apples, try using fresh pears or even a mix of berries for a colorful and fruity variation.

Chef Emma’s Helpful Tips

  • Make-Ahead: These cheesecake bars do well when made a day ahead. Just store them in the refrigerator and serve chilled or at room temperature!
  • Ingredient Swaps: Feel free to replace shortbread cookies with graham crackers for a different flavor base or use gluten-free cookies for a gluten-free version.
  • Slicing Tips: For clean slices, use a sharp knife dipped in warm water. Wipe it clean between cuts for those picture-perfect pieces.
  • Storage Suggestions: If you find yourself with leftovers (which I doubt!), cover them tightly in the fridge for up to 3-4 days.
